Abstract
One of the major issues in the modeling of subwavelength optical materials resides in how to compute the effective properties of such media. An efficient technique must be able to describe appropriately the electromagnetic response of the overall structure. Within this context, this work is focused on the calculation of effective parameters of metallic silver nanowires embedded in alumina background. An algorithm based on modal propagation is considered in order to estimate the refractive index at the visible spectrum. The resonances obtained in the computing model are compared to the predictions of analytical Bruggeman and Maxell-Garnett theories and analyzed by regarding excitation of surface modes at the metal-dielectric interface.
